Input: cros_ec_keyb - fix button/switch capability reports

The cros_ec_keyb_bs array lists buttons and switches together, expecting
that its users will match the appropriate type and bit fields. But
cros_ec_keyb_register_bs() only checks the 'bit' field, which causes
misreported input capabilities in some cases. For example, tablets
(e.g., Scarlet -- a.k.a. Acer Chromebook Tab 10) were reporting a SW_LID
capability, because EC_MKBP_POWER_BUTTON and EC_MKBP_LID_OPEN happen to
share the same bit.

(This has comedic effect on a tablet, in which a power-management daemon
then thinks this "lid" is closed, and so puts the system to sleep as
soon as it boots!)

To fix this, check both the 'ev_type' and 'bit' fields before reporting
the capability.

Tested with a lid (Kevin / Samsung Chromebook Plus) and without a lid
(Scarlet / Acer Chromebook Tab 10).

This error got introduced when porting the feature from the downstream
Chromium OS kernel to be upstreamed.
